Output 3640895aa0917a4c7a69b183820fc3cd5a75d17831127df6b2bee8501e28d94b:0

value
21367
script pubkey
OP_0 OP_PUSHBYTES_20 3a2e9ff0e23154c73e938b2a16c583d018b2a220
address
bc1q8ghflu8zx92vw05n3v4pd3vr6qvt9g3qcru6p5
transaction
3640895aa0917a4c7a69b183820fc3cd5a75d17831127df6b2bee8501e28d94b